I think those statistics are all wrong on what color car gets pulled over more. I just wonder how accurate it is. If you look at it this way...
There are probably more red cars on the road than anything else. And there are probably less brown cars on the road than anything else. So, if there are 100 cars in a given stretch of road how many of those do you think are going to be brown? Do you see where I'm coming from here? If 50% of the cars on the road are red, wouldn't it seem that approximately %50 of the tickets handed out would be to people driving a red car?
